A minimal HTTP server written in C that serves static HTML pages. It uses a thread pool to efficiently handle multiple client connections concurrently.
- Serves static HTML pages from
static-pages/
directory. - Uses a fixed-size thread pool to handle concurrent clients.
- Proper HTTP response headers, including
Content-Length
andContent-Type
. - Graceful handling of file not found or read errors.
- Graceful shutdown on Ctrl+C: cleans up thread pool and closes sockets properly.
- Easy-to-extend architecture for future features (dynamic pages, MIME types, etc.).

- Open a terminal in the project root folder.
- Run the following commands:
make clean
make run
make clean
removes old object files and executable.make run
compiles and runs the server.
- The server listens on port 8080 by default.
- Open a web browser and go to:
- The server will serve
static-pages/index.html
. - Press Ctrl+C to stop the server gracefully. The thread pool will be destroyed, and all sockets will be closed properly.

- Currently, the server always serves
index.html
. - You can extend it to parse the HTTP request and serve different pages based on the URL.
- MIME types are currently hardcoded as
text/html
. - Graceful shutdown ensures no memory leaks or dangling threads when stopping the server.
